What is recorded here
Scotland's National Record of the Historic Environment records Coldrochie as Henge (neolithic) - (bronze Age), Pit Circle (prehistoric)(possible), Rig and Furrow (medieval) - (post Medieval), Timber Circle (neolithic) - (bronze Age)(possible). The official map says its point is accurate as follows: NGR given to the nearest 1m. The record does not by itself mean that the public may enter the place.
